    Anjali Menon is an Indian film director and screenwriter who predominantly works in Malayalam cinema. Anjali has won international, national and state awards for her work and is best known for her feature films Manjadikuru, Kerala Cafe (Happy Journey), Ustad Hotel, Bangalore Days, Koode and Wonder Women.     Anjali Menon is an alumna of London Film School with a Masters in Filmmaking and another Masters in Communication Studies. She makes films and writes stories about family, gender, social movements and cultural thresholds in Malayalam, Hindi and Tamil.
